CSScaffold
A dynamic CSS framework inspired by Shaun Inman's CSS Cacheer. It's aimed at experienced CSS developers - it gives you the tools to create great CSS easily. It abstracts some repetitive and annoying flaws of the language to make it easier to create and maintain, all while giving you the benefits of caching.
- Constants
- SASS-style mixins
- Compressed, Cached and Gzipped on-the-fly
- Nested Selectors
- Perform PHP operations
- Image replace text by just linking to the image file
- Plus easily add your own functionality using the plugin system
What you need
- PHP5+
- modrewrite enabled in Apache (optional)
